JURY SELECTION STARTS IN JENNIFER HUDSON FAMILY MURDERS

CHICAGO (AP) -- Jury selection has begun in the trial of the man accused of killing Jennifer Hudson's mother, brother and nephew in October 2008. Potential jurors filled out questionnaires yesterday in Chicago, and the judge will question them Monday. Prosecutors say William Balfour shot Hudson's relatives because he was jealous that his estranged wife -- Hudson's sister -- was dating another man. Balfour greeted the jurors good afternoon and many of them responded in kind. Hudson's name is on the list of potential witnesses. The judge has also banned reporters from posting updates to Twitter, Facebook and similar sites from inside the courtroom because the constant typing could be distracting. Court officials will monitor the reporters' accounts to make sure.
